As of 2008, not including the two live albums "Music as a Weapon" and "Music as a Weapon II", they have 4 albums released.
These are:
The Sickness [2000]
Believe [2002]
Ten Thousand Fists [2005]
Indestructible [2008],
There have been other minor albums released, such as the iTunes only "Live & Indestructible", but I have listed the current commercially available one's(ie, the one's you can pick up at any record store, excluding, the two live Music as a Weapon CD's).

Disturbed has three albums that have gone platinum: The Sickness (4x Platinum), Believe (Platinum) and Ten Thousand Fists (2x Platinum).
They covered Tears for Fears "Shout" on their first album "The Sickness". They also covered "Land of Confusion" by Genesis on their album "Ten Thousand Fists".
